Unfortunately, they won't care that you weren't aware of it. It's just common practice. Sounds silly, but it's not just Platincasino's policy. One of the reasons is probably to prevent abuse of the welcome bonus.

I'm not saying that I think this rule is good, on the contrary, it's one of those bullshit rules that are sneaky and nasty. There are quite a few of them (e.g. that you can't play with a bonus higher than 4€ etc.).


What I'm saying is that you hardly stand a chance because it's a violation of the terms of use (ban on multiple accounts) and will be penalized with cancellation of the wins. Regardless of whether you did this consciously or unconsciously, it's hard for them to judge. In addition, Platin has a Curacao license, which means that they are hardly accessible anyway. Here you can only hope for goodwill - but the casino has already decided.
